#f3573c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f3573c is composed of 95.3% red, 34.1% green and 23.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 64.2% magenta, 75.3% yellow and 4.7% black. It has a hue angle of 8.9 degrees, a saturation of 88.4% and a lightness of 59.4%. #f3573c color hex could be obtained by blending #ffae78 with #e70000. Closest websafe color is: #ff6633.

#f3573c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f3573c has RGB values of R:243, G:87, B:60 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.64, Y:0.75,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 15947580.

Shades and Tints of #f3573c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080201 is the darkest color, while #fef6f5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#f3573c
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9b9594 is the less saturated color, while #fb5134 is the most saturated one.
